    Dumbbell Over Bench Single Arm Wrist Curl

    The dumbbell over bench one arm wrist curl is an isolation exercise targeting the forearm muscles. It is performed seated, with the forearm resting on a bench and the wrist curling a dumbbell upward.

    How to Perform

    1. 1

      Sit on a bench with your feet flat on the ground and hold a dumbbell in one hand, palm facing down.

    2. 2

      Rest your forearm on the bench with your wrist hanging off the edge.

    3. 3

      Slowly curl your wrist upwards, bringing the dumbbell towards your forearm.

    4. 4

      Pause for a moment at the top, then slowly lower the dumbbell back down to the starting position.

    5. 5

      Repeat for the desired number of repetitions, then switch to the other arm.

    Pro Tips

    • Position your forearm on the bench with your palm facing down and wrist hanging off the edge for a full range reverse curl.
    • Curl the wrist upward slowly, focusing on the contraction of the extensor muscles along the top of your forearm.
    • Use very light weight (3-10 lbs) since the wrist extensors are significantly weaker than the flexors.

    Common Mistakes

    • Using the same weight as palms-up wrist curls, which is too heavy for the wrist extensors and causes poor form.
    • Moving too quickly and using momentum instead of a slow, controlled wrist curl motion.
    • Allowing the forearm to rock on the bench instead of staying firmly planted.
